gfortran 相关问题

gfortran是GNU Fortran编译器,是GCC的一部分。它实现了Fortran 95标准和Fortran 2008标准的大部分内容。该标签应特别用于与gfortran的使用和行为有关的问题;有关Fortran语言或更广泛编译器的问题应该包括Fortran标记。

使用Fortran从文件中提取特定行

我正在尝试编写一个从给定文件中提取指定行的函数。我这样做的函数有两个参数:fUnit:这是给定文件的数字标识符。 fLine:这是......

回答 2 投票 3

如何使用模块为Fortran程序创建makefile

挑战是创建一个makefile,该makefile包含模块列表,并且不需要我进行优先排序。例如,模块是mod分配。f08mod精度定义。f08...

回答 1 投票 4

如何在fortran中分配矩阵值

这是我的2×2矩阵程序矩阵的简单程序INTEGER :: A(2,2)integer :: i,j do i = 1,2 write(*,*)A(i,1),A(i, 2)结束做结束程序,当我运行和编译时,我得到...

回答 1 投票 -1

如何在OpenMPI中使用gprof编译Fortran代码进行性能分析?

我可以使用gfortran编译器编译我的Openmpi代码。我给出的编译语法是:mpif90 -o mycode.exe mycode.f90 mpirun -np 4 ./mycode.exe它的工作原理。现在我想描述我的代码......

回答 1 投票 1

为什么在Fortran上进行黎曼和逼近时,中点规则比Simpson规则更准确

大家。我正在使用中点规则和Simpson规则来计算[1,2]中x ^ 2的积分。而且我发现具有相同数量的子区间中点规则......

回答 1 投票 0

gfortran与ifort的等价选项

我曾经使用ifort和以下选项编译代码:-openmp -O2 -i-static -i8 -g -mkl -p -132我想现在用gfortran编译,但选项不同。我知道 - 开放......

回答 1 投票 0

MinGW gfortran编译错误:“无法识别的选项'-plugin'”

我正在尝试在我的Windows机器上启动并运行Fortran编译器,但由于某种原因我无法让它工作。我已经安装了最新MinGW的“基本设置”部分,我正在尝试......

回答 1 投票 1

当由gfortran编译时,带有绑定(C)的Fortran C-可互操作子模块过程报告错误

考虑以下Fortran模块Foo_mod及其子模块Foo_smod,模块CallbackInterface_mod抽象接口函数getLogFunc4C_proc(ndim,Point)结果(logFunc)bind(C)...

回答 1 投票 1

在gfortran中的INQUIRE(inpunit,flen = iflen)中的语法错误,但在Lahey中没有

我尝试使用gfortran编译我的代码。我收到此错误:** INQUIRE(inpunit,flen = iflen)1错误:INQUIRE语句中的语法错误(1)**此代码之前已编译...

回答 1 投票 0

无法使用错误链接IRAF库重定位R_X86_64_32

我正在尝试编译一个用Fortran编写的名为DAOSPEC的程序。它给了我以下错误(在其他类似的情况下):/ usr / bin / ld:/home/osboxes/iraf/bin.linux64//libimfort.a(imakwc.o):...

回答 1 投票 0

链接静态HDF5 Fortran库

所以我有一个小的Fortran库,为HDF5 Fortran调用提供了一些包装器。我还有一个小测试,调用库中定义的接口。我知道问题与我的方式有关...

回答 1 投票 0

Fortran中打开命令的错误操作(Insted read open命令打开.txt文件)

这是我的简单代码:Program Example_Code Implicit none Integer :: iERR Open(Unit = 15,File ='Read_Something.txt',Action ='Read',Status ='Unknown',iostat = iERR)If(iERR / = 0 )...

回答 1 投票 0

边界点a和b内的蒙特卡洛积分的Fortran代码

我知道蒙特卡罗模拟是通过绘制随机点并计算曲线外部和曲线内部之间的比率来估算面积。我很好地计算了......

回答 1 投票 1

Fortran PURE函数可以使用全局参数吗?

在我看来,Fortran中所谓的纯函数对于那些使用函数式编程的人来说并不算纯粹。所以这是我的问题。假设我有以下代码:MODULE ...

回答 2 投票 5

可分配数组的内存分配问题(实际类型)

我是Fortran编程的新手,所以我需要有关可分配数组的帮助。这是我的简单代码:PROGRAM MY_SIMPLE_CODE IMPLICIT NONE INTEGER :: N_TMP,ALLOC_ERR,DEALLOC_ERR REAL,ALLOCATABLE,...

回答 1 投票 0

Msys2 - > f951.exe:致命错误:在第2行第1列读取模块'...':意外的EOF

我试图在Win 10 + Portable Msys2下使用带有gfortran 8.2.0的模块。在Ubuntu 18.04LTS下,这个问题没有出现在gfortran 7.3.0中。在没有编译我的实际案例之后,我把...

回答 1 投票 2

gfortran中为零

有没有办法在gfortran强制下溢到下溢?我不敢相信这是第一次有人问这个,但我找不到任何东西。 Mea culpa如果这是......

回答 2 投票 4

在维度attr-spec和entity-decl中同时声明array-spec

此代码在gfortran,Intel Fortran和Solaris Studio中编译,维度(:) :: A(2)print *,size(A)end结果为2.但是,当在维度中尝试另一个array-spec时。 。

回答 1 投票 2

gfortran:如何控制.mod文件的输出目录

有没有办法将由gfortran(GCC)生成的.mod文件放入一个单独的输出目录?我知道如何使用-o标志放置目标文件或其他输出,如:gfortran -c test.f03 -o / ...

回答 2 投票 4

gfortran生成对模块文件的依赖

我想使用gfortran为Makefile生成合适的规则,其中包含使用模块的源代码。例如,如果在src1.f90程序编程中使用module1 ...结束程序并在mod_mymods.f90模块中...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.